Every atom makes one free electron in copper. If 1 . 1 A Current is flowing in the wire of copper having 1 mm diameter, then the drift velocity (approx.) will be (density of copper = 9 × 10 3 k g m - 3 and atomic weight of copper = 63 )

Options

  1. A0.1 m m s - 1
  2. B0.2 m m s - 1
  3. C0.3 m m s - 1
  4. D0.2 m m s - 1

Correct answer

A. 0.1 m m s - 1

Step-by-step solution

v ⁡ d ⁡ = i ⁡ n ⁡ Ae ; where n ⁡ = N A ρ M ⁡ = 6.023 × 10 26 × 9 × 10 3 63 = 0.860 × 1 0 2 9 = 8.6 × 10 28 and A = π D 2 4 = 22 7 × 10 - 3 2 4 m 2 ; = 11 14 × 10 - 6 m 2 v d = 1.1 8.6 × 10 28 × 11 14 × 10 - 6 × 1.6 × 10 - 19 = 1 9.6 × 1 0 + 3 = 1 0 0 × 1 0 - 4 9 6 = 1.0 × 1 0 - 4 m s - 1 = 0.1 m m s - 1
